What's Pocket Card Jockey: Ride On!?

By LUDWIG VON KOOPA - A sequel? A remaster? I dunno, but here's some ideas.

Today, in unexpected but quite appreciated news, GAME FREAK announced that Pocket Card Jockey, their best game in the past 10 years, will be coming to Apple Arcade in a form called Pocket Card Jockey: Ride On!.



What kind of game is this? Well, let's check out the 30-second trailer and the Apple Arcade page for it.



That trailer portrays a game that is very similar to Pocket Card Jockey. The starting two rows of Solitaire to begin a race with a certain amount of Unity Power with different and better moods on a Giddyap button; the names of the races (Kingfisher); the gameplay is identical with comfort zones and abilities; the music is the same; the final 200 metre homestretch dash at the end with the boosts. However, there are small differences if you look closely. Stamina Monster is a horse characteristic/skill that isn't in the first Pocket Card Jockey. And the screenshots have several new details.

Pocket Card Jockey: Ride On! screenshot montage differences from 3DS version Apple Arcade
Top left: Stamina Monster is new. Also, the design of the track in the bottom right corner is new and appears to include a short-cut? There's never been short-cuts.
Top right: This menu design is new, and Game Center is a new feature. The UI was previously Stables, Shop, Museum, Calendar, Tips, and Save. (And Next for a race.)
Bottom left: A clothing shop is completely new.
Bottom right: Happy Horses shop in the first game prices things in the low hundreds when on sale, or several thousands normally. A two-digit coin economy is drastically rescaled. Puzzle pieces are also missing.


The Apple Arcade page describes how Pocket Card Jockey's “basic rules are the same [from the Nintendo 3DS version], [but] the racing segments have been reborn in glorious 3-D!” I wonder if the use of “reborn” here is meant to imply Pocket Card Jockey: Ride On! as a remaster of Pocket Card Jockey rather than a sequel, similar to Pokémon Shining Pearl and Pokémon Brilliant Diamond.

It's very important to note that Pocket Card Jockey: Ride On! is currently exclusive to Apple Arcade, releasing on January 20, 2023 in English, Japanese, French, German, Italian, and Spanish. There's no word on it coming to the Switch. Pocket Card Jockey gameplay is quite reliant on a touch screen, and while the Switch DOES have a touch screen, hardly anyone remembers that this is the case and it definitely needs non-touch alternatives. Maybe motion controls would be a fun alternative. (I think this is why Big Brain Academy: Brain vs. Brain wasn't the best experience, because it was touch or inferior button.)
